Bondo job from 3 years ago on a Tacoma finally cracked in the Oregon rain

I saw a truck I fixed up back in 2021 come through the shop last week and the filler split right along the seam I thought I'd sanded smooth, what causes old repairs to fail after all that time like that?

Damn dude that sucks. Moisture probably got trapped behind the filler and started pushing it off from the inside. Did you use a self-etching primer on the bare metal before you laid down the bondo? That's usually the main thing that prevents stuff like this if you're working with a truck that sees rain.
